Join us for an insightful webinar if you are an expat or planning to move overseas, this event right for you.

This event will provide valuable strategies to help you secure your financial future, wherever you call home.

Key topics include:

  • Understanding the unique financial challenges faced by U.S. expats
  • Pension options and considerations for Americans abroad
  • Investment strategies tailored to the American expat lifestyle
  • Tax implications and how to optimize your financial planning
  • Tips for starting early and maximizing your long-term financial security
  • Various American expat tax implications (Box 3, PFICs, Inheritance tax)
  • How US retirement plans work in The Netherlands

About The Speakers
Alex Gover
Alex is a senior financial adviser, who focuses on helping UK and US expats worldwide with their finances, particularly international investments and retirement planning. He works at SJB Global, is associated with the North American Securities Administrators Association, and is an educator for expats on cross-border investment options while offering comprehensive retirement plans.

Puneet Gupta
Puneet is the co-founder and CEO of Aequify, a fintech platform focused on simplifying cross-border financial organisation and tax-compliance workflows for expats and internationally mobile families. He brings a personal understanding of the risks involved: a cross-border filing error reportedly cost him $7,400, helping inspire Aequify’s mission

Konner Gershkoff
Konner is the Head of the Internal Sales team at Advisors Capital Management. Konner has led the efforts into the International, Cross-Border Advice markets for Advisors Capital and works hand-in-hand with Financial Advisors to provide compliant, customized, tax efficient investment portfolios for their clients. He has several years of experience strictly focusing on International Markets and working within permitted jurisdictions across the globe to help bridge back USD assets to US based custodians like Fidelity and Charles Schwab. He understands the importance of providing compliant solutions for individuals abroad that wish to continue to invest USD but do so with proper reporting. He holds a Finance Degree from the University of Rhode Island and is a key part to the Institutional Team at Advisors Capital
